## Deployment

This section covers deploying the revamped password reset flow for Lumenpass. The new flow replaces the legacy token table with signed, short-lived reset links, so both services must run side by side during migration. Deploy the new reset service first, verify health checks pass, then flip the router flag; rolling back simply means reverting the flag. Support staff should note that in-flight legacy tokens remain valid for 48 hours after cut-over. The deployment expects the configuration values listed below.

service settings:
PRAIX_LOG_LEVEL=error
PRAIX_METRICS_HOST=metrics.praix.qorvelcorp.corp
PRAIX_POOL_SIZE=16

Welcome to the support rotation for PointsPal, our loyalty-points ledger! When a customer asks where their points went, your first stop is the Ledger Lookup tool — it shows every accrual, redemption, and adjustment in order. Don't eyeball the mobile app screenshots; they cache hard and lie often. Adjustments over 5,000 points need a lead's sign-off, so ping whoever's on shift in the support channel. To run lookups against the ledger service, you'll need the team's shared key, which is below.

app token of tagef-tafog = qvz3-7n0

**Vendor note: Inkmill markdown pipeline**

Rendering for Parchway docs is outsourced to Inkmill under an annual contract, renewing each March. They handle sanitization and PDF export; we own the upload queue. SLA: 4-hour response on rendering failures. Escalate only after two failed retries. Their support desk is reachable at the address below.

billing contact of hahaf-baguf = zorael.tammir.jorius@sivrelhq.internal

## Build Provenance: Inkmill Markdown Pipeline

Quick rundown for reviewers: every render of the Inkmill pipeline is traceable back to a signed source snapshot. The sanitizer, the parser grammar, and the HTML emitter are all pinned by hash in the manifest, so if someone swaps a stage, the provenance check screams. We rebuild the whole chain hermetically — no network fetches mid-render, ever. If you're auditing an output page, grab its manifest first. The token for the current attested build follows.

build token for fahap-yagag: htk3_d09